Back to our own game, we are obviously very ecstatic with the win over the Warriors in our final round-robin game, and it is pleasing to put two clinical performances together as we had a good win over the Eagles in the game before.
To be honest, I was a bit surprised about how comfortable the win over the Warriors was, because all our matches this season – in Supersport Series and MTN40 – have been really tight.
I just think that we performed exceptionally, and having a guy with the class of Jacques Rudolph always helps. I honestly think it won’t be long before the national selectors call him up again.
Having batted so well, it was great to see the guys hitting their straps in the field. It is something that we have been working on, and it’s good to see the hard work pay off.
I enjoyed chipping in with a few wickets out there, but I though the standout performance was by David Wiese.
It’s not very easy to get a fiver in four overs, and I told him that if he ever tops that performance, I would love to be there!
Looking ahead to our semi-final against the Lions, I think that it will be a great scrap against our neighbours. We always have a hard game against them, but I think we are hitting some form at the right time and hope we can seal it in two games rather than a decider!
